1. Specifications Comparison
| Feature | Motorola Razr 40 Ultra | Realme C67 | Practical Impact |
|---|---|---|---|
| Design | |||
| Dimensions (mm) | 170.8 x 74 x 7 | 165.7 x 76 x 7.9 | Razr 40 Ultra is significantly more compact when folded, but thicker when unfolded. Realme C67 is a standard candybar design. |
| Weight (g) | 184.5 | 190 | Razr is slightly lighter despite the folding mechanism. Negligible difference in real-world usage. |
| Foldable | Yes | No | Razr's foldable design offers portability but introduces potential durability concerns and a crease on the main display. |
| Display | |||
| Display Type | Foldable LTPO AMOLED | IPS LCD | Razr offers superior contrast, deeper blacks, and potentially better power efficiency with LTPO. Realme C67's LCD is less vibrant. |
| Display Size (inches) | 6.9 | 6.72 | Comparable screen real estate. |
| Resolution | 1080 x 2640 | 1080 x 2400 | Similar sharpness; Razr is slightly taller due to aspect ratio. |
| Refresh Rate (Hz) | 165 | 120 | Razr provides smoother animations and scrolling. Noticeable difference in day-to-day use, especially in gaming. |
| Peak Brightness (nits) | 1400 | 680 (typical), 950 (HBM) | Razr is significantly brighter, ensuring better visibility outdoors. |
| Performance | |||
| Chipset |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 | Mediatek Dimensity 6100+ | Razr boasts a flagship-level processor, offering significantly better performance in demanding tasks like gaming and multitasking. |
| CPU | Octa-core (1x3.19 GHz X2 & 3x2.75 GHz A710 & 4x1.80 GHz A510) | Octa-core (2x2.2 GHz A76 & 6x2.0 GHz A55) | Razr's CPU architecture is more powerful and efficient. |
| GPU | Adreno 730 | Mali-G57 MC2 | Razr's GPU provides a substantial advantage in graphics-intensive applications and games. |
| RAM (GB) | 8/12 | 6/8/12 | Razr offers configurations with more RAM, improving multitasking and app loading times. |
| Camera | |||
| Main Camera (MP) | 12 | 108 | Realme has a higher megapixel count, potentially capturing more detail. However, sensor size and processing play a bigger role in image quality, which is not fully detailed here. |
| Selfie Camera (MP) | 32 | 8 | Razr has a significantly better selfie camera in terms of resolution. |
| Video Recording | Up to 4K@60fps with HDR, EIS | 1080p@30fps | Razr offers superior video recording capabilities with higher resolution, frame rate, and HDR. |
| Battery | |||
| Capacity (mAh) | 3800 | 5000 | Realme C67 has a larger battery capacity, potentially lasting longer on a single charge. However, Razr's LTPO display could offset this difference. |
2. Key Differences Analysis
Motorola Razr 40 Ultra Advantages:
- Significantly more powerful: The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 provides a substantial performance advantage for demanding tasks and gaming.
- Superior display: The foldable AMOLED with a 165Hz refresh rate offers vibrant colors, deeper blacks, smoother scrolling, and better outdoor visibility.
- More compact when folded: Offers excellent portability.
- Better video recording capabilities: Higher resolution, frame rate, and HDR support.
Realme C67 Advantages:
- Larger battery capacity: Potentially longer battery life.
- Lower price: Offers a more budget-friendly option.
- Standard candybar design: More durable and familiar form factor.
- Higher resolution main camera (on paper): While megapixels alone don't guarantee quality, the 108MP sensor could potentially capture more detail.
Trade-offs:
- Razr 40 Ultra: Higher price, potential durability concerns due to the folding mechanism, smaller battery capacity.
- Realme C67: Significantly lower performance, less vibrant display, bulky compared to folded Razr.
3. User Profiles & Recommendations
Motorola Razr 40 Ultra: Ideal for users who prioritize portability, cutting-edge technology, a premium display, and strong performance, and are willing to pay a premium for it. Use cases: Mobile gaming, content consumption, multitasking, showcasing innovative technology.
Realme C67: Suitable for budget-conscious users who prioritize battery life and basic smartphone functionality. Use cases: Casual browsing, social media, communication, light productivity tasks.
